Output ef2e08bd5924c26766c6d36f1ac4d7a9a31c48c051c0ac4db93d7d5933a0bc88:3

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 ebfacb630881399a17a63cfbf1d08501bd981bcf
address
tb1qa0avkccgsyue59ax8nalr5y9qx7esx70jlerwk
transaction
ef2e08bd5924c26766c6d36f1ac4d7a9a31c48c051c0ac4db93d7d5933a0bc88